随着科技的飞速发展,交通领域也在不断变革。增强现实(AR)技术作为一项前沿技术,正在逐渐改变我们的出行方式。本文将深入探讨增强现实交通辅助系统如何革新出行体验。
一、增强现实技术简介
增强现实(AR)是一种将虚拟信息叠加到现实世界中的技术。通过AR技术,用户可以看到、听到、触摸和与虚拟信息进行交互。在交通领域,AR技术可以提供实时、直观的信息,辅助驾驶员更好地掌握路况。
二、增强现实交通辅助系统的应用场景
- 导航辅助:AR导航系统可以将虚拟道路信息叠加到现实世界中,帮助驾驶员更直观地了解路线和路况。
// Java代码示例:AR导航系统基本框架
public class ARNavigationSystem {
public void displayRoute() {
// 获取实时路况信息
RouteInfo routeInfo = getRouteInfo();
// 将虚拟路线叠加到现实世界
overlayRouteOnWorld(routeInfo);
}
private RouteInfo getRouteInfo() {
// 获取实时路况信息
// ...
return new RouteInfo();
}
private void overlayRouteOnWorld(RouteInfo routeInfo) {
// 将虚拟路线叠加到现实世界
// ...
}
}
- 车辆信息显示:AR技术可以将车辆信息实时显示在挡风玻璃上,避免驾驶员分心,提高行车安全。
# Python代码示例:AR车辆信息显示
import cv2
import numpy as np
def displayVehicleInfo(image, vehicleInfo):
# 将车辆信息叠加到图像上
cv2.putText(image, vehicleInfo, (50, 50), cv2.FONT_HERSHEY_SIMPLEX, 1, (0, 255, 0), 2)
return image
- 交通标志识别:AR系统可以实时识别交通标志,提醒驾驶员注意道路情况。
// JavaScript代码示例:AR交通标志识别
function recognizeTrafficSign(image) {
// 使用深度学习模型识别交通标志
// ...
return recognizedSign;
}
- 行人检测:AR系统可以检测行人和障碍物,提前预警,避免事故发生。
// C++代码示例:AR行人检测
#include <opencv2/opencv.hpp>
void detectPedestrians(cv::Mat& frame) {
// 使用深度学习模型检测行人
// ...
}
三、增强现实交通辅助系统的优势
提高行车安全:AR技术可以提供实时、直观的信息,帮助驾驶员更好地掌握路况,减少交通事故。
提升驾驶体验:AR系统可以提供更加丰富、有趣的驾驶体验,让驾驶变得更加轻松愉快。
降低驾驶疲劳:AR技术可以将信息投射到挡风玻璃上,减少驾驶员分心的次数,降低驾驶疲劳。
四、未来展望
随着技术的不断进步,增强现实交通辅助系统将会在更多场景中得到应用。未来,AR技术将与人工智能、大数据等技术相结合,为驾驶员提供更加智能、安全的出行体验。
总之,增强现实交通辅助系统正在逐步革新我们的出行方式,为未来交通领域的发展带来无限可能。
